One of the advantages to FoCal Pro is access to the FoCal camera/lens comparison database. The Nikon D850 runs in User Assisted Mode, most all the process is automated, users will be prompted a few times to change the AF Fine Tune during a calibration (see video showing Nikon D800 AF calibration to get an idea of what’s involved). This release brings full support for the hotly anticipated Nikon D850 to Reikan FoCal. Improvement to comparison data generation and use within FoCal.Update to metadata analyser for better camera/lens recognition. Improvement for Canon with High Sierra in some cases (see section on High Sierra below).Improvement during startup on Mac for Canon camera connections.macOS High Sierra Support with Nikon – All Nikon cameras are supported with Reikan FoCal and High Sierra (10.13).Full Nikon D850 Support Added – automated D850 focus calibration with Reikan FoCal.We’ve been busy working on full High Sierra support, it’s not a completely done deal yet sadly (at least with Canon cameras) more details below. In addition we’ve made some handy improvements within FoCal, including to the lens comparison database generation. We’re delighted to announce FoCal 2.6 for Mac and Windows is ready for release! Nikon’s newest dSLR camera the D850 is now fully supported within FoCal.
